Property summary

262 W Roosevelt Blvd is a 1935-built single family in the Feltonville section of 19120, last assessed at $176,900. From the early 20th century, the building predates modern plumbing and electrical codes and may include lead paint, asbestos, or knob-and-tube wiring. It has changed hands 4 times, most recently selling for $32,500 in 1986. Of 7 code violations on file, 1 remain open. The property is owned by Jordan Diane S/W.
